Aims and Scope
The Journal of Construction Economics is an official, peer-reviewed academic journal. The core mission of the Journal is to advance the science of economics and management within the construction industry through the publication of high-quality research.
The scope of the Journal focuses on the following key objectives:
-
Scientific Publication: Publishing original scientific research, review articles, and policy evaluations related to the field of construction economics.
-
Technology Transfer: Introducing and promoting the application of new models, methodologies, and technologies (e.g., Building Information Modeling - BIM, digital cost management) into construction practices.
-
Bridging Theory and Practice: Providing in-depth updates on the research and strategic developments of the Institute of Construction Economics, serving as a vital link between academic theory and practical governance.
